OnlyFans is a subscription-based social media platform that allows content creators to sell exclusive content to their fans. Launched in 2016, the platform has gained significant attention in recent years, particularly among adult content creators. OnlyFans has become a lucrative platform for individuals to monetize their content, with top creators earning millions of dollars.
